Domestic Bases. 17.3.1. MINIMUM STAFFING LEVEL If the Company desires to establish any Base inside the contiguous United States and the District of Columbia, the Base will be staffed initially with at least four (4) crews by Type. The average annualized staffing at the base will be maintained at a minimum of four (4) crews. 17.3.2. Domestic Bases a. A domestic Base is any Base that the Company permanently utilizes in connection with the operations of its Company Airline Client within the contiguous United States, the District of Columbia, Hawaii, Alaska, and Puerto Rico. b. If there are no successful bidders or the number of successful bidders is not sufficient to staff a new domestic Base, the Company may employ new hires or Junior Assign existing Flight Attendants to fill such vacancies.
